George A. Romero Will Be the Guest of Honour of the 13th Grossmann Festival

We proudly announce that the greatest and most important contemporary horror director George A. Romero is coming to the 13th edition of Grossmann Fantastic Film and Wine Festival that will take place between the 11th and the 15th of May in Ljutomer, Slovenia.
 
 
His influence on contemporary cinema cannot be overestimated. He made history already with his first feature Night of the Living Dead (1968) which has caused a revolution within genre cinema. With this film, horror has irreversibly entered the modern age and left behind all the old movies which suddenly became old fashioned, harmless and even naive.  It was one of the most successful independent films in the history of cinema, while even the US Library of Congress selected it for preservation in the National Film Registry, which is an honour only seldomly given to films of that genre. Together with its sequels Dawn of the Dead (1978) and Day of the Dead (1985) it forms one of the most influential film trilogies of all time. Just take a look at today’s media landscape, you will have a hard time avoiding zombies. They became the dominant cultural fear and at the same time the essential political metaphor for the exploitation and numbness of the masses.
 
Last year, Night of the Living Dead has been digitally restored by New York’s Museum of Modern Art and The Film Foundation. After numerous special screenings at prestigious festivals, such as Berlinale and Venice, not attended by George A. Romero, this glorious genre milestone will be screened at this year’s Grossmann in the presence of the author. Our program will also feature a special retrospective of his films and a Master Class, and of course you’re all invited to the festival closing ceremony to honour him when he will receive the honorary Vicious Cat award.
 
Befitting this year’s theme, there will be a Special Makeup Effects Workshop led by none other than the legendary Sergio Stivaletti. Europe’s greatest special and makeup FX grandmaster has collaborated on more than 50 films with directors such as Dario Argento, Michele Soavi, Lamberto Bava and Gabriele Salvatores. He is also the founder of the unique special effects school Fantastic Forge which is based in Rome. More information on this special workshop will be available soon.
